Geographical Distribution

Spain

According to the incidence data, Spain accounts for the majority of 'Munguira' occurrences. The frequency of this surname within the Spanish population indicates a strong likelihood that many descendants share common ancestry, posing an interesting avenue for genealogical research. The concentration of this surname may particularly point to specific regions with a rich historical context or cultural significance in relation to the name.

Brazil

Moving across the Atlantic, Brazil presents a unique cultural mosaic, where the surname 'Munguira' appears with an incidence of 25. The influx of Spanish immigrants to Brazil during various immigration waves could explain the presence of the surname. The diverse blend of cultures and names in Brazil often leads to the evolution or modification of foreign surnames, which could be a subject of interest for genealogists tracing the Brazilian lineage of 'Munguira.'

Argentina

Argentina, with an incidence of 4, showcases another chapter in the migration story of 'Munguira.' The connection to Argentina may date back to the late 19th and early 20th centuries when European migration flourished, enriched by the promise of new opportunities. Researching immigration records could provide insights into how the surname established its footing in Argentina and developed its familial tree there.

Germany, Wales, Mexico, and the United States

The surname appears less frequently in other countries such as Germany, Wales, Mexico, and the United States, each recording only one incidence.
